我知道 AVD 管理器可以运行多个模拟器,但在过去几天的新版本中,它停止了工作。它不再执行启动 4 个命令提示符窗口的操作,并且只有一个加载栏,但现在我无法同时运行 1 个以上的命令提示符窗口。当我单击开始时,加载栏完成,但没有加载模拟器,没有可见的更改。
Eclipse 中的 logcat 中唯一的错误是:
07-04 10:12:18.563: D/SntpClient(71): request time failed: java.net.SocketException:
Address family not supported by protocol
不知道这是否相关。
编辑
有时启动模拟器时我似乎也会遇到这个问题:
Starting emulator for AVD 'Android_2_2_480x854'
WARNING: Data partition already in use. Changes will not persist!
WARNING: SD Card image already in use: C:\Users\USERNAME\.android\avd\Android_2_2_480x854.avd/sdcard.img
ko:Snapshot storage already in use: C:\Users\USERNAME\.android\avd\Android_2_2_480x854.avd/snapshots.img
这是另一个开发团队创建的应用程序,我们只是一个测试团队,所以我无法更改任何内容(只需测试 apk)。
到目前为止尝试过的事情:
- 重启亚行
- 在 Google 上查找错误
- 重启ADB管理器/
蚀
是的,自从更新后也不适合我。已举报至Google 问题 http://code.google.com/p/android/issues/detail?id=34221订阅/投票该问题,以便他们尽快解决。
同时,一个不错的选择是设置一个运行 x86 Android 版本的 Virtual Box。它也比 ARM 模拟器快得多,尽管设置网络有点棘手,而且不像从 Eclipse 创建和启动模拟器那么自动。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)